Section 3: Essential Tools, Software, and Hardware

Software Solutions for Video Photo Editor Software

A variety of editing platforms are available to support Video Photo Editor Software. These can be broadly categorized as:

  • Industry Standards: Programs such as DaVinci Resolve that offer comprehensive functionalities.
  • Accessible Software: Options such as OpenShot which are suitable for beginners.
  • Collaborative Software: Services like WeVideo that allow editing from anywhere.

Hardware Considerations

To optimize the power of Video Photo Editor Software, your hardware should be modernized:

  • Powerful Workstations: Machines with dedicated GPUs to handle complex editing tasks.
  • Additional Hardware: This is complemented by graphic tablets to improve accuracy.
  • Archival Devices: Implementing RAID arrays is essential to safeguard your work.
